Therapeutic Approaches That Translate Well to Online Care
Stephanie Bevills integrates evidence-informed methods that can be well suited to online therapy.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) focuses on identifying unhelpful thought patterns and behaviors, then practicing new skills that support steadier mood and more effective coping. It is often used for concerns like anxiety, depression, stress, and obsessive or compulsive patterns.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) helps clients make room for difficult thoughts and feelings while taking steps toward what matters most to them. It can be especially useful when guilt, shame, or worry keeps life feeling constrained, and it supports building resilience through values-based action. Mindfulness Therapy may also be incorporated to strengthen present-moment awareness and improve the ability to respond rather than react during emotionally intense situations.
